Rev. Michael Langer serves as the Associate Director of Ministry to State, the denominational ministry of the PCA to those serving in government. He has planted churches in his hometown of Iowa City, IA, and the Chicago suburbs. Michael is the former Chicago City Director for Made to Flourish and has been a board member of The Call to Work, a church-based curriculum for vocational discipleship, since its development. He and his wife of 30 years live in NW DC.
